9 Effective Ways to Protect Your Hair This Winter

      Winter is upon us. Time to indulge in a cup of hot tea and play in the snow. But it is also time to take extra care of your natural hair. Cold weather is not exactly a Dynasty Diva’s friend. Winter cold air is harsh to all hair types and typically dries your hair out.   

            As such it is vital that you show it some extra love this season. Here are 9 tips to help you do exactly that.

  1. Use protective style

                      A protective style is any hairstyle that tucks your ends away. The ends of your hair are the most fragile of your hairs, second to your edges. Tucking them away protects them from cold winter air, which would otherwise damage them. 

                     In addition to that, protective styles give us a breather from manipulation of our hair which makes it weak. This in turn promotes hair growth. When you install a protective style, remember that your hair still needs to be cared for under that protective hair.

  1. Let’s talk co-washing.

          When you need to wash your hair, in between your shampooing day or you don’t want to use a shampoo, co-washing is the next best option.

          Co-washing simply means that you wash your hair with conditioner only. In this situation, your conditioner replaces your shampoo in your washday routine. Co-washing helps as you get to retain a lot of moisture in your hair. 

     Here’s how to co-wash:

  • Squeeze out enough conditioner to cater for all your hair.
  • Massage conditioner into your scalp and a use scrubbing motion, to remove dirt from your scalp then distribute throughout your hair shaft.
  • Rinse out the conditioner thoroughly
  • Apply a second round of conditioner, this time apply to the hair ends and work your way upwards on your hair shaft.
  • Rinse out the conditioner
  • Follow up with a deep conditioner

 

  1. You still need to deep condition

                    Each time you shampoo or co-wash your hair, follow up with deep conditioning.

                   Deep conditioning helps moisturize your hair. For a dynasty diva, moisture is a really important thing to her hair. Hair that is not moisturized well, ends up being brittle and weak as it is dry. This eventually leads to it being damaged and it undergoing breakage.

           Furthermore, deep conditioning helps to keep your hair healthy. Here are a couple of deep conditioning tips:

  • Apply the deep conditioner on damp hair to ensure that it penetrates well.
  • After applying the deep conditioner, wear a shower cap or a hair steamer on your hair and wait for 20 minutes. The heat from the natural hair steamer helps the product penetrate your hair. If you don’t have a hair steamer you can use a shower cap instead.
  • Apply the deep conditioner to the ends first and work your way up the hair shaft.
  • Apply the right amount of deep conditioner. Not too little not too much.
  • Rinse off with cold water to close the hair cut ideas, enabling moisture to be trapped.

 

  1. LOC in that moisture

                       You’ve worked hard to help your hair obtain some moisture, now it’s time to lock in that moisture. The best way to do this is by LOC or LCO method. LOC/LCO stands for Leave-in Conditioner, Cream and Oil. It is an acronym that tells you what to apply to your hair and in what order, after deep conditioning or when you need to moisturize your hair.

  1. Avoid heat styling 

                       During this cold season, our main aim is to try to maintain as much moisture as possible in your hair. Using heat to style your hair dries it out, making it more vulnerable to the harsh effects of cold weather. Heat styling involves the use of heat styling tools such as flat irons and blows dryers to straighten out your curls.
